Located in Rabuor, the Mwanzo Wetu Centre of Excellence Academy (MWCEA) is a vibrant early childhood and primary school serving more than 445 students from preschool through nine. Students learn from trained and certified teachers, enjoy two hot and nutritious meals each day using environmentally safe cooking methods, and participate in clubs and activities that build leadership, creativity, and global awareness. Before MWCEA opened its doors, no primary school in Rabuor and neighboring communities had daily meals or a modern learning environment. Today, the school’s laboratories and computer lab are the first steps into a STEM focused curriculum in addition to clean and safe water systems have become a source of deep community pride. MWCEA is more than a school. It is a foundation for lifelong opportunity. As students graduate, they continue through the High School Scholars Program, where they receive mentorship, school placement support, and financial assistance to ensure their education continues without interruption. Together, these programs prepare young people for meaningful careers in Rabuor and beyond.
